Southern desserts are a perennially hot subject for bakers who appreciate tradition and craft. In this book, a fresh, new voice in food writing pulls traditional recipes out of the kitschy country kitchen, adding new flavors and streamlining technique, bringing beloved sweets up to date for modern tastes and and presenting original recipes that lovers of Southern desserts will embrace as new favorites.
Combining delicious recipes, expert tips on ingredients and technique, and charming anecdotes from growing up in the Deep South, Sweet & Southern feels more like a delicious afternoon in the kitchen with your gossipy best friend than a cookbook.

Originally from Kosciusko, Mississippi, Ben Mims grew up amid the classic dessert traditions of the deep South, including a towering caramel cake after church every Sunday.He combines a journalism degree from the University of Mississippi with a certificate from the French Culinary Institute in New York.For five years, Ben worked as associate food editor for Saveur magazine, eventually writing their long-running "Pantry" column.His March 2012 cover story "Sweet Southern Dreams" was featured in Best Food Writing 2012.More recently, he was executive pastry chef at San Francisco's James Beard Award-nominated Bar Agricole, and has developed recipes for EveryDay with Rachael Ray and Southern Living.This is his first book.
